Analysis of Traffic Accident Characteristics of Expressway Tunnels

In order to determine the accident characteristics of expressway tunnels and improve the safety of tunnel driving, through the analysis of data from ten expressways and adjacent road sections in Zhejiang Province for six consecutive years, the paper summarizes differences between tunnel sections and adjacent road sections in terms of accident rate, accident severity, accident time, accident pattern, and accident weather. Then divides the tunnel section into five sections, and processes the accident data of each section by mathematical statistics to obtain the accident characteristics of different sections of the tunnel. The results show that the tunnel section has a "magnification effect" on traffic accidents, the proportion of accident rate in expressway tunnel sections is higher than that of common road sections, but tunnel sections are more affected by traffic volume; under 90% confidence level, the accident rate of tunnel entrance area is generally higher than that of exit area.
